CloudPanel Community Edition up to 2.5.1 HTTP Header /admin/users Referer redirect

Summaryinfo

A vulnerability classified as problematic has been found in CloudPanel Community Edition up to 2.5.1. The impacted element is an unknown function of the file /admin/users of the component HTTP Header Handler. Performing a manipulation of the argument Referer results in redirect. This vulnerability is identified as CVE-2025-15241. The attack can be initiated remotely. Additionally, an exploit exists. It is recommended to upgrade the affected component.

A vulnerability was found in CloudPanel Community Edition up to 2.5.1. It has been classified as problematic. This affects some unknown processing of the file /admin/users of the component HTTP Header Handler. The manipulation of the argument Referer with an unknown input leads to a redirect vulnerability. CWE is classifying the issue as CWE-601. A web application accepts a user-controlled input that specifies a link to an external site, and uses that link in a Redirect. This simplifies phishing attacks. This is going to have an impact on integrity.

It is possible to read the advisory at github.com. This vulnerability is uniquely identified as CVE-2025-15241. The exploitability is told to be easy. It is possible to initiate the attack remotely. It demands that the victim is doing some kind of user interaction. Technical details and a public exploit are known. The attack technique deployed by this issue is T1204.001 according to MITRE ATT&CK.

The exploit is shared for download at github.com. It is declared as proof-of-concept.

Upgrading to version 2.5.2 eliminates this vulnerability. The upgrade is hosted for download at github.com.
